October 1, 2021; Singapore – Ether Cards, the platform whose technology has brought real-world utility to the creation of dynamic NFTs for Steve Aoki and other prominent public figures, announced today that Aoki, the world-renowned artist, DJ, entrepreneur, and philanthropist, has acquired one of the rarest and valuable NFTs from the Ether Cards Collection – the #99 OG Card. Today, the price of an Ether Cards OG card ranges from $120,000 to over $1 million on OpenSea. Only 99 OG cards exist. Total sales volume for Ethercards on OpenSea stands over 2500 ETH (~US$7,831,400) with over 210 ETH (~US$656,672) in the last week.

Aoki’s acquisition comes just a day after the initial distribution of Dust tokens and Ether Cards’ 27 CryptoPunk giveaway to the Ether Cards community on September 30. The Dust tokens can be used within the Ether Cards ecosystem to exchange for NFTs, participate in exclusive early-access NFT sales, build and manage NFT functionality, and unlock advanced features on the platform amongst other planned future functionality.

Andras Kristof, Ether Cards Founder and CEO, says, “Steve Aoki is a true Dynamic NFT pioneer both as a creator and collector. His own issued Dynamic NFTs using the Ether Cards technology have set a real standard for how an artist can involve and engage their community. It’s a great pleasure to sell the very special #99 OG to Steve.”

As one of the most valuable cards in the collection, Aoki’s OG card received 100,000 Dust tokens on September 30th and will accumulate Dust continuously. As part of the Ether Cards’ giveaway campaign, 1,000,000 Dust tokens can be exchanged for one of the 27 CryptoPunks. Mr. Aoki already owns two CryptoPunks.

Steve Aoki says, “I think that the logical progression of where NFTs are going is a deeper and interactive experience between creators and fans facilitated by attaching real-world utility to NFTs. It’s something I’ve been doing on my own in the Discord channel I started, and now something I’ve been able to do by partnering with Ether Cards who through their pioneering Platform have developed a way to add that interactivity directly to NFTs. Purchasing the super rare #99 OG Ethercard is exciting for me for many reasons especially around the release of Ether Cards’ Dust token. I see it as not only investing in Ether Cards’ long-term success but the market and space as a whole.”

This acquisition marks the significance of Ether Cards position in the Dynamic NFT space as it prepares for the public launch of its NFT self-serve platform.  Ether Cards’ self-serve platform allows any artist, brand, athlete, or public figure to create, launch and manage dynamic NFTs to engage, grow, and monetize their communities.

About Steve Aoki

Counting nearly 3 billion music streams to his name, Steve Aoki is a true visionary. Billboard described the 2x-GRAMMY-Nominated artist/DJ/producer and Dim Mak Records founder as “one of the most in-demand entertainers in the world.” As a solo artist, Aoki boasts a lauded cross-genre discography that includes 7 studio albums and collaborations with Lil Uzi Vert, Maluma, BTS, Linkin Park and Louis Tomlinson amongst others.

In 1996, he established Dim Mak out of his college dorm room, a trendsetting record label, events/lifestyle company and apparel brand. It has served as a launch pad for global acts like The Chainsmokers, Bloc Party, The Bloody Beetroots, and The Kills, in addition to being the home of early releases from acts such as ZEDD and Diplo.  As a nightlife impresario, Aoki’s legendary Hollywood club night Dim Mak Tuesdays hosted early performances from future superstars such as Kid Cudi, Daft Punk, Lady Gaga, and Travis Scott.

A true renaissance man, Steve Aoki is also a fashion designer, author and entrepreneur. In 2012, he founded THE AOKI FOUNDATION, which primarily supports organizations in the field of brain science research with a specific focus on regenerative medicine and brain preservation. In addition, Aoki has pushed his clothing line Dim Mak Collection to new heights, both with original designs and collaborations with everyone from A Bathing Ape to the Bruce Lee estate. Aoki’s multi-faceted journey is chronicled through the Grammy-nominated Netflix documentary I’ll Sleep When I’m Dead (2016) and his memoir BLUE: The Color of Noise(2019). In the summer of 2020, Aoki unveiled his Latin music imprint, Dim Mak En Fuego, continuing to break down musical and cultural boundaries ‘by any means necessary.’
